India vs Australia 1st ODI: Match preview, head-to-head and streaming details

In the head-to-head competition between the two teams in the 50-over format, Australia have acquired a massive lead.

After the conclusion of the high-octane Border-Gavaskar Trophy, the two giants of world cricket will take on each other in the three-match ODI series. The first fixture will take place on Friday, March 17, at the Wankhede Stadium in Mumbai at 1:30 PM IST.

The first ODI will see the Men in Blue entering the field without their regular captain, Rohit Sharma, and the side will be captained by Hardik Pandya. In the absence of Rohit, a big headache arises for the Indian team as to who will face the first ball. On the brighter side, the young Shubman Gill and Virat Kohli have been in some serious form since the beginning of 2023. The pace battery of the side will be heavily dependent upon Mohammed Shami and Mohammed Siraj. The home team would like to carry forward its momentum from the longest format to the white ball cricket and go 1-0 up in the series after securing the first game. It would be interesting to see how the Indian camp functions in this bilateral series without two of its most important players, Jasprit Bumrah and Rishabh Pant.

On the other end, the Aussies will also play without their regular captain, as Pat Cummins won’t be returning for the upcoming series. The top-order batter, Steve Smith will be captaining the side and will look to finish the tour on a positive note. With the ICC Men’s ODI World Cup 2023 being held in India, Australia will look forward to analysing and understanding the conditions well enough before they return to the subcontinent for the mega event. The Aussie line-up has a rich experience of playing in India and could posses a serious threat to the Indians.

Head-to-head:

In the head-to-head competition between the two teams in the 50-over format, Australia have acquired a massive lead. The two sides played against each other on 143 occasions, the Aussies won 80 and lost 53 games.
